About Aleut

Formed in 2013, ARS Aleut Services, LLC (Aleut) is a Small Business Administration (SBA) certified 8(a) program participant and Small Disadvantaged Business. Aleut provides a variety of technical services for federal customers including records management and information technology services. Aleut is ISO 9001:2015 certified through independent registrar, QAS International (Certificate No. US4620J). ARS Aleut Services, LLC is a wholly owned subsidiary of Aleut Federal, LLC, a holding company for federal subsidiaries of The Aleut Corporation.

GSA 8(a) STARS III Contract Holder
Contract No. 47QTCB22D0678

ARS Aleut Services, LLC (Aleut) is an established contract holder on  U.S. General Services Administration (GSA) 8(a) Streamlined Technology Acquisition Resource for Services (STARS) III – a/k/a/ “8(a) STARS III.” This best-in-class, small business set-aside, government-wide acquisition contract (GWAC) provides the government with flexible access to customized information technology (IT) solutions from a large, diverse pool of 8(a) industry partners.

The contract, number 47QTCB22D0678, was awarded with a five-year base period through July 1, 2026, followed by a three-year option which will run until July 1, 2029. As such, the contract provide opportunities for long-term solutions for contracting officers, providing flexibility to accommodate extended periods of performance. The scope includes a range of services from simple to complex and services-based solutions such as IT help-desk support, information assurance, cybersecurity, and artificial intelligence.

Aleut is prepared to support the 8(a) STARS III scope with subject-matter expertise spanning a multitude of disciplines, including DevSecOps, Agile Transformation, Application Modernization, Cloud Services, Platform Services, Data Management and ERP.

541412 – Computer Systems Design Services will serve as the Primary North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code for the contract. However, anything that is IT service(s) in nature has the potential to fall within the contract scope.

The 8(a) STARS III GWAC provides numerous benefits to federal customers including expanding capabilities for emerging technologies, support both inside and outside the continental United States, and limited protestability up to $10 million dollars.
